Sydney's Annual Indigenous Art Fair

The National Indigenous Art Fair (29 & 30 June) is an ethical Festival held on Gadigal Land and founded by charity organisation First Hand Solutions Aboriginal Corporation.

Everyone is welcome

The National Indigenous Art Fair offers a unique opportunity to experience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ander art and culture from remote community-owned art centres from the Northern Territory, Queensland, South Australia and Western Australia.

A cultural experience like no other

This annual arts and culture festival is in its fifth year and features a vibrant program of live Indigenous music, cultural dance performances and interactive experiences for adults and children.

Featuring works from remote community artists

The fair offers the unique opportunity to meet artists from remote ethical art centres. Artists have travelled long distances from around the country to collaborate in Sydney and share their stories with you. Hear first hand the stories behind the art

And local NSW Indigenous artists

More than 30 stallholders from around regional and remote New South Wales, will also be featured. See, touch and smell their incredible art, jewellery, gifts, homewares, and Indigenous bush food and plants.

Learn to weave with an Aboriginal Master Weaver

Regina Pilawuk Wilson, from Peppimenarti in the Northern Territory will teach you to make your own creation that you will treasure forever.
Other workshops include a children's craft workshop and a painting class with Kunwinjku artists Arnhem Land's Injalak Arts Centre.
